Outside Contributors

Six Reasons to Set Up a Business Abroad

Six Reasons to Set Up a Business Abroad

There are plenty of reasons that someone should open a business, but opening a business in a whole new country could be the best idea you’ve ever had. There are places around the world that are business centers and you can bet that setting up a business abroad is going to change the game for your future plans. If you’re feeling stifled by the current economic climate or the conditions in your country, then you should want to ensure that you can experience culture and lifestyle in a whole new way.

Opening a business in general is tough but if you want to do better, then why not go abroad with it? Making sure that you have your EOR and your visa for the new country that you open a business in is important, but so is knowing why you should go for it. Below, we’ve got six reasons that you should set up a business abroad.

Photo by Anastasia Shuraeva from Pexels
  1. You’ll get a lot of attention. There is no process that is easy about setting up a business, but going abroad with your business idea will garner a lot of attention. You want to do this, but you need to work hard. On one hand, you want to open your business and get it right but on the other, you want an adventure, right? 
  2. There’s so much room for growth. Being abroad gives you a chance to really spread your business wings. The economy is growing at a faster rate than in some developed nations, and so you need to go somewhere that you can capitalize on that. There are fewer restrictions on businesses in some developing countries, too. 
  3. You can be introduced to a new market. One of the biggest benefits of being in a new market is that it’s brand new. You’re slipping on into a market that is brand new for you which gives you the right professional and personal growth that you need.
  4. The financial benefits. Did you know that many companies out there offer tax incentives and financial benefits to those with new business ideas? You can find a place with financial incentives that give you something amazing. These will help you to ensure that you have a great base to work from.
  5. You’ll find a new approach. When you work in a business of your own in a foreign country, you will learn the way the locals do things. This means that you get to face a whole new approach that you might not have considered before.
  6. You’ll find new talent. Being in a new country can open you up to new talent that gives you a whole new way of working. You’ll be able to understand what it means to have a great work ethic in a whole new way. A new pool of talent means that you have new skilled workers who want to work with you. It’s a good way to find talented employees for your business especially when you are finding it hard to hire at home.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.